Beef and Broccoli Stir Fry
Servings
4
Ingredients
- 1 lb Beef sirloin, boneless (may substitute top round 3/4 " thick)
- 2 Tbsp Cornstarch
- 14.5 oz Can, Beef broth, clear
- 1 tbsp Brown sugar, packed
- 1 tbsp Soy sauce
- 1/4 tsp Ginger, ground
- 1/4 tsp Garlic powder
- 4 cups Mann's Broccoli Wokly®
- 4 cups Rice, hot cooked
Directions
Slice beef into very thin strips. In a bowl, mix cornstarch, 1 cup of broth, brown sugar and soy until smooth. Set aside. Spray skillet with cooking spray and heat over medium-high heat for 1 minute. Add beef in two batches and stir fry until brown. Set beef aside. Using the same skillet, add remaining broth, garlic powder, ginger and Mann’s Broccoli Wokly®. Heat to a boil. Cover and cook over low heat 5 minutes or until broccoli is tender-crisp. Mix cornstarch with water and add to broccoli. Cook until mixture boils and thickens, stirring constantly. Return beef to pan. Heat through. Serve over rice.
